In a delightful reunion, former Parks and Recreation co-stars Nick Offerman and Jim O'Heir found themselves on the same flight together last month. Offerman, who played the gruff but endearing Ron Swanson on the beloved NBC sitcom, decided to surprise his on-screen colleague O'Heir, who portrayed the bumbling but sweet Jerry Gergich.
As the plane was about to land, Offerman took to the aircraft's speaker system and began making announcements, referencing his character's iconic traits. He poked fun at the various names Jerry was wrongly called by his colleagues, including Gary, Larry, and Terry. The flight attendants were also in on the prank, further enhancing the experience for the passengers.
O'Heir, who didn't realize Offerman was on the flight until the surprise unfolded, was thrilled by the unexpected reunion. He later shared a video of Offerman's announcements, capturing the actor's signature Ron Swanson charm as he delivered the safety instructions with a twist.
The two actors, who were part of the ensemble cast of Parks and Recreation from the beginning, have maintained a close friendship since the show's conclusion in 2015.
